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C) and greasing a 9×13 inch baking pan. A non-stick spray or a thin layer of softened butter will do the trick. This preparation step ensures your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ake bakes evenly and releases beautifully after cooking.
Step 2: Beat the Eggs and Sugar
In a large mixing bowl, combine the eggs and sugar, then beat them together using a hand mixer or stand mixer on medium speed for 5-7 minutes. Continue until the mixture becomes thick, pale, and forms a ribbon when you lift the beaters — this is key for achieving a light cake texture.
Step 3: Add Butter and Vanilla
Once your egg and sugar mix is at the right consistency, add in the softened butter and vanilla extract. Mix on medium speed for about 2 minutes until the ingredients blend into a smooth, creamy mixture. This will provide richness and enhance the flavor profile of your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ake.
Step 4: Incorporate the Flour
Gently fold in the all-purpose flour with a spatula or wooden spoon until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can lead to a dense cake. You should see a few streaks of flour remaining; it’s important not to worry about it being perfectly homogeneous at this stage.
Step 5: Add the Cranberries
Now it’s time to incorporate the fresh cranberries into your batter. Use the spatula to fold them in gently; this ensures they are evenly distributed without breaking. Their vibrant color and tartness will shine through in the final product, making your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ake truly delightful.
Step 6: Pour the Batter
Carefully pour the cake batter into your prepared baking pan. Use the spatula to smooth out the top, ensuring it’s evenly spread. This will help the cake cook uniformly, leading to a beautiful rise and even texture throughout.
Step 7: Bake the Cake
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 40-50 minutes. Start checking for doneness at the 40-minute mark by inserting a toothpick into the center; it should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s. The cake should be lightly golden on top and spring back when pressed gently.
Step 8: Cool Before Serving
Once baked, remove the cake from the oven and allow it to cool completely in the pan on a wire rack. This cooling process helps the flavors meld together and makes slicing easier. Once cooled, slice your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ake into squares and prepare to serve!

Make Ahead Options
These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ake preparations make holiday meal planning a breeze! You can mix the batter up to 24 hours in advance and refrigerate it—this allows the flavors to meld beautifully. If you wish to bake the cake ahead, consider making it up to 3 days prior and storing it in an airtight container at room temperature. For longer storage, wrap the cooled cake tightly in plastic wrap and freeze for up to 3 months. To serve, simply thaw overnight in the fridge before cutting and enjoying a slice of this delightful cake, which remains just as delicious as the day it was baked.
Helpful Tricks for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ake
-
Perfect Egg Beating: Make sure to achieve that ribbon stage when beating eggs with sugar; it’s essential for a light and airy cake.
-
Avoid Overmixing: Gently fold in the flour to prevent a dense texture. A few streaks of flour are okay, so don’t overdo it.
-
Parchment Paper Prep: Lining your baking pan with parchment paper can make cake removal a breeze. This little trick saves time and frustration!
-
Check for Doneness: Start checking the cake at the 40-minute mark with a toothpick. The cake should be lightly browned and spring back when touched.
-
Let It Cool: Allowing the cake to cool completely before slicing is crucial for clean cuts and a richer flavor in your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ake.

How to Store and Freeze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ake
Room Temperature: Store the c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days to maintain its moist texture.
Fridge: If you prefer, refrigerate the cake for up to 1 week; be aware it may become denser over time.
Freezer: Wrap individual slices in plastic wrap and foil, then fre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w before serving for the best taste.
Reheating: To enjoy a warm slice, gently heat in the microwave for about 15-20 seconds, maintaining the cake’s delightful moisture.

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ake Recipe FAQs
How do I choose the best cranberries for my cake?
Absolutely! When selecting fresh cranberries, look for those that are firm and plump, with a vibrant red color. Avoid any that have dark spots or are mushy, as they might indicate overripeness. Fresh cranberries are typically available in grocery stores during the holiday season.
How should I store my leftover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ake?
To keep your cake delicious, store it in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. If you choose to refrigerate, it can stay fresh for up to 1 week, but be aware that the refrigeration process may make it a bit denser.
Can I freeze slices of the Cranberry Christmas Cake?
Yes, you can definitely freeze your cake! Wrap individual slices tightly in plastic wrap, then foil, and store them in the freezer for up to 3 months. To enjoy, simply thaw the slices in the fridge overnight or leave them at room temperature for a couple of hours before serving. If you want a warm slice, pop it in the microwave for about 15-20 seconds.
What should I do if my cake turns out dense?
If your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ake is denser than expected, it might be due to overmixing when incorporating the flour. To prevent this, gently fold in the flour until just combined, and ensure that the eggs and sugar are beaten to the ribbon stage for a light texture. Also, using the right size pan and checking for doneness at the appropriate time can make a huge difference!
Is this recipe suitable for people with dietary restrictions?
Very! This Festive Cranberry Christmas Cake can easily be adapted for different dietary needs. For a gluten-free version, substitute the all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end. If you’re looking for a vegan option, replace eggs with flax eggs (mix 1 tablespoon of ground flaxseed with 3 tablespoons of water and let it sit for 5 minutes) and ensure that all other ingredients are plant-based. This makes it a wonderful choice for everyone at your holiday gathering!
How do I enhance the flavor of my cake?
To elevate the flavor of your Cranberry Christmas Cake further, you can add a teaspoon of cinnamon or nutmeg to the batter for a warm, holiday spice. Another delightful option is to blend in some citrus zest, like orange or lemon, which will brighten up the overall flavor profile. Feel free to experiment with your favorite nuts, like chopped walnuts or pecans, for an added crunch!
